Security And Privacy

To ensure the healthy development of the ecosystem, developers need to conscientiously comply with all terms and agreements. This is not only a legal and moral obligation but also an important measure to maintain user trust and protect user information security.

In the current technological environment, security and privacy issues are attracting increasing attention. Developers must prioritize the collection, storage, and use of user data when designing and developing applications, ensuring compliance with relevant laws and regulations. Additionally, developers should implement appropriate security measures, such as encrypting sensitive data, conducting regular security audits, and performing vulnerability assessments to prevent potential security threats.

At the same time, maintaining transparency is crucial. Developers should clearly inform users how their information will be used and provide easy ways for users to manage their privacy choices. Only through these efforts can developers protect user privacy while promoting the healthy and sustainable development of technology.

In summary, while complying with terms and agreements, developers must prioritize data security and user privacy to lay a solid foundation for the continued development of the ecosystem.

Common Security and Privacy Protection Measures Examples

Data Encryption:

Use encryption techniques such as AES (Advanced Encryption Standard) and HTTPS (Hypertext Transfer Protocol Secure) to protect user data during transmission and storage from unauthorized access.

Principle of Least Privilege:

Only collect and use the necessary data required by the application, avoiding the collection of additional personal information to reduce the risk of data breaches. Authentication and Authorization:

Implement strong authentication mechanisms (such as two-factor authentication) and fine-grained authorization management to ensure that only authorized users can access sensitive information and features.

Regular Security Audits:

Conduct regular security audits and vulnerability scans to identify and remediate potential security issues promptly, maintaining the application's security.

User Privacy Options:

Provide clear privacy settings that allow users to easily manage their privacy choices, such as opting out of data collection or deleting their personal information.

Use of Security Libraries and Frameworks:

Utilize community-maintained security libraries and frameworks, which are widely tested and help ensure the security of the application.

Continuous Monitoring and Response:

Employ monitoring tools and response plans to promptly address security incidents and data breaches, enhancing the application's security posture.
